The Onboarding Coordinator provides administrative support for Headlight’s onboarding processes across clinical and non-clinical teams. This role is responsible for coordinating manual onboarding steps, partnering with HR and IT to support onboarding needs, maintaining accurate employee records in HR systems, primarily ADP. The position helps create an excellent, personalized onboarding experience for each new hire while supporting consistent, organized, and timely HR operations. 
 
This role is hybrid 3 days per week in the office Tuesday-Thursday.

  • Onboarding & New Hire Integration 

    • Coordinate onboarding activities across cross-functional departments, including Recruiting, HR, IT, L&D and Clinical Operations, to ensure a seamless and timely new hire experience. 

    • Coordinate onboarding activities for new hires using Lever, HubSpot or ADP(HRIS) onboarding tools 

    • Prepare and process onboarding documentation; employee profiles, I-9, W-4, direct deposit, etc. 

    • Ensure all pre-employment and onboarding tasks are completed in a timely manner 

    • Serve as a point of contact for new hires during onboarding 

    • Track onboarding progress and follow up on missing information or documents 

    • Coordinate and schedule onboarding meetings, including first-day and first-week agendas 

    • Participate in new hire welcome sessions, ensuring a positive and organized introduction to the company 

    • Arrange introductions between new hires, managers, and key team members 

    • Partner with hiring managers to ensure role-specific onboarding plans are prepared and executed 

    • Ensure all required stakeholders (IT, payroll, benefits, etc.) are aligned for new hire readiness 

    • Track completion of onboarding meetings and ensure follow-through on action items 

    • Serve as an additional point of contact to support new hires during their initial onboarding period 

    HRIS & Data Entry 

    • Maintain and update employee records in HR systems (ADP and internal databases) with a high degree of accuracy 

    • Perform high-volume manual data entry, including new hire information, employee profile set up and registration in supplementary software systems  

    • Audit HR data regularly to ensure completeness and compliance 

    • Assist with correcting discrepancies and maintaining data integrity 

    PTO & Vacation Scheduling 

    • Manage PTO and vacation requests, ensuring accurate tracking in HR systems 

    • Work in collaboration with Scheduling Team to maintain Clinician calendars and support managers with scheduling visibility 

    • Monitor balances and assist employees with questions regarding time off policies 

    • Ensure compliance with company policies regarding leave and scheduling 

    General HR Support 

    • Assist with day-to-day HR administrative tasks and recordkeeping 

    • Generate basic HR reports as needed 

    • Support HR team with audits, documentation, and compliance activities 

    • Respond to employee inquiries related to HR systems, onboarding, and PTO
